Bestia 2013 Moomba Mojo
This has been a long time coming, I demoed this boat back in Oct at the Polar Bear event, and knew right then it was time to upgrade from my 08 LSV.
I think a lot of people will recognize this boat as it was posted up on the net quite a bit. Shane Stillman had this boat built, and we like to think it was fate and really built for us because it matches our truck, has all the options we would have picked, and the thing i hated most about the Mojo was the Tower, and this one has a 1 off custom Skylon tower. We tested it with 2 hours on the engine, We added 2 hours the day we tested it, and we took delivery in January 13 with a total of 5 hours on the boat. Since then this boat has went through many changes, I removed the hump under the drivers dash to make room for a custom Exile Big 15 and sub box. I removed all the stock stereo and amp rack. I made a custom amp rack with cut outs behind each amp to allow better cooling. Amp 2 Exile 800.4 1 Exile Harpoon 1 Exile 2500.1 ZLD was added 3 Pairs of XM9s 3 pair of Exile SX65M cabins Added a custom Battery Box and cover for the 2 Interstate 2400 U golf cart batteries. Removed and Limo Tinted the Windshield Plasti Diped all the Moomba Logos, and Mojo Logos For Ballast she has 2 Enzo 1500L bags in the rear Lockers 500 Hard tank in the floor 650 IBS in the bow Also I have added a X link pump that allows you to drain the Regular bag into the Goofy bag or vis versa to make switching from Reg to Goofy in under 10 minutes. Last but not Least a custom made Evolution cover, should be delivered this week. http://i639.photobucket.com/albums/u...ps43c84ded.jpg http://i639.photobucket.com/albums/u...ps966902fd.jpg http://i639.photobucket.com/albums/u...ps293e6c61.jpg |
